path: root/meta-fri2
diff options
authorNitin A Kamble <>2013-01-25 01:38:02 (GMT)
committerTom Zanussi <>2013-01-25 04:51:13 (GMT)
commit521a8a6bc41bc11bd29b60b5f90a495a38a3bed0 (patch)
tree2d35e8d0340e14161fc6ad055541fab45297db5e /meta-fri2
parentf3bccf8f0c91b4edff480327895dff5efb792f82 (diff)
fri2.conf: use the new method for specifying VA codecs
This replaces the old VA_FEATURES method to specify the codecs. These VA codecs are included in the image when image has 'hwcodec' in the IMAGE_FEATURES. And one can disable the VA features by redefining the IMAGE_FEATURES var in the local.conf . The gst-va-intel package pulls in emgd driver and x11 pieces, hence it is moved to the XSERVERCODECS var. Signed-off-by: Richard Purdie <> Signed-off-by: Nitin A Kamble <> Signed-off-by: Tom Zanussi <>
Diffstat (limited to 'meta-fri2')
1 files changed, 4 insertions, 6 deletions
diff --git a/meta-fri2/conf/machine/fri2.conf b/meta-fri2/conf/machine/fri2.conf
index 12184b2..40f2cdc 100644
--- a/meta-fri2/conf/machine/fri2.conf
+++ b/meta-fri2/conf/machine/fri2.conf
@@ -9,14 +9,12 @@ require conf/machine/include/
9require conf/machine/include/ 9require conf/machine/include/
10require conf/machine/include/ 10require conf/machine/include/
11 11
12# Some of the EMGD components have dependency on libx11. 12MACHINE_HWCODECS ?= "va-intel"
13# Add these only when Xserver is enabled with the EMGD driver 13XSERVERCODECS ?= "emgd-driver-video emgd-gst-plugins-va \
14# Otherwise unwanted X components will start showing up in the non-X images 14 emgd-gst-plugins-mixvideo gst-va-intel"
15VA_FEATURES ?= "gst-va-intel va-intel \
16 ${@bb.utils.contains("XSERVER", "emgd-driver-bin", "emgd-driver-video emgd-gst-plugins-va emgd-gst-plugins-mixvideo", "", d)}"
17 15
18MACHINE_FEATURES += "wifi 3g pcbios efi va-impl-mixvideo" 16MACHINE_FEATURES += "wifi 3g pcbios efi va-impl-mixvideo"
19MACHINE_EXTRA_RRECOMMENDS += "linux-firmware-iwlwifi-6000g2a-5 ${VA_FEATURES}" 17MACHINE_EXTRA_RRECOMMENDS += "linux-firmware-iwlwifi-6000g2a-5"
20 18
21PREFERRED_PROVIDER_virtual/kernel ?= "linux-yocto" 19PREFERRED_PROVIDER_virtual/kernel ?= "linux-yocto"
22PREFERRED_VERSION_linux-yocto = "3.4%" 20PREFERRED_VERSION_linux-yocto = "3.4%"